- [ ] **Password reset revamp (Tidemark Accounts):** Confirm the new reset flow is live before answering tickets. Reset links now expire after 30 minutes instead of 24 hours, and users must re-enter their username on the reset page. Expect a short spike in "link expired" contacts during the first week; use the updated macro in Helpforge. Escalate anything involving locked accounts to tier two. Reference this release by the build token below.

session token of fahop-tawig = htk3_da3

Ticket: The nightly fleet fuel-usage report for the Harrowline delivery vans stopped generating on Monday. Root cause is the expired credential used by the report job to query the Lanternfeed telemetry service. The job itself is fine; no code changes needed beyond swapping the credential and bumping the config version. Reviewer: please confirm the new secret is referenced from the vault path rather than inlined. For local verification, the replacement key is below.

service key, fajof-fahaf: vxb3-dv3

**Ticket: Image slimming config drifted from reviewed baseline**

While reviewing the Brambleport build pipeline PR, I compared the slimmer settings in CI against what we actually agreed on last quarter, and they've drifted. Someone bumped the layer-squash threshold and disabled the dead-binary pruning pass directly in the runner config, so our "slim" images are about 40% fatter than the baseline we signed off on. Can you sanity-check the diff before I open a revert? The values currently live in CI are these.

service settings:
WENATH_PIN=5007
WENATH_METRICS_HOST=metrics.wenath.tolvaqlabs.corp
WENATH_LOG_LEVEL=debug
WENATH_TENANT=rusox

**Vendor note: Inkmill markdown pipeline**

Rendering for Parchway docs is outsourced to Inkmill under an annual contract, renewing each March. They handle sanitization and PDF export; we own the upload queue. SLA: 4-hour response on rendering failures. Escalate only after two failed retries. Their support desk is reachable at the address below.

billing contact of hahaf-baguf = zorael.tammir.jorius@sivrelhq.internal